It was high time to get back to podcasting around these parts, and tonight was the best time to get back to it. Marty Brennaman is calling his final game tomorrow, Eugenio Suarez keeps pounding dingers, and the devolution of the 2019 Cincinnati Reds has our focus on the pending 2020 season - and the moves it will require to make that a good one.

Tony and Grimey joined me to break down just what Marty’s career has meant to us as varying members of the millenial age, how Suarez has continued to improve at the plate, and just what the Reds will have to navigate this upcoming offseason given the fleet of injuries and surgeries to key parts of what could be their core going forward.
